These patterns didn’t appear out of nowhere.
Maybe you grew up believing love meant being helpful.
Conflict was scary and should be avoided.
Maybe you learned to put everyone else's needs before your own.
Those coping strategies may have helped you then…
But after a breakup or divorce, they left you questioning yourself, overthinking every interaction, and struggling to trust your own intuition.
The goal of therapy isn't to blame or vilify your past.
It's to understand it with compassion so you can begin making different choices moving forward.
Many clients discover that what they've called self-sabotage is actually their nervous system trying to protect them.
